Morson Human Resources Limited is seeking a Principal Electrical Engineer for a permanent position in Dorset. You will lead the design and integration of electrical systems for cutting-edge maritime projects, contributing significantly to our advanced sonar and submarine technology programmes.
The role requires strong knowledge of electrical system design and offers a competitive salary along with excellent benefits including career development opportunities, private medical insurance, and a bonus scheme.
Join a dedicated and forward-thinking team at TKMS ATLAS UK.
